Overview of the Elgato Facecam Pro 2026

The Elgato Facecam Pro 2026 is the latest addition to Elgato’s line of premium webcams designed specifically for content creators and professionals. It boasts a 4K resolution sensor, advanced autofocus, and improved low-light performance. Its sleek design and user-friendly interface make it appealing for both beginners and seasoned users.

Key Features

  • Resolution: 4K Ultra HD at 30 fps for crisp, detailed video
  • Autofocus: Fast and accurate, ensuring sharp images at all times
  • Low-light performance: Enhanced sensor technology for clear images in dim environments
  • Built-in privacy shutter: Conveniently cover the lens when not in use
  • Connectivity: USB-C for fast and reliable connection
  • Adjustable mount: Compatible with various setups and monitors

Performance in Professional Settings

The Facecam Pro 2026 delivers exceptional video quality that meets the demands of professional Zoom calls. Its 4K resolution ensures sharp visuals, which can be crucial for presentations, interviews, and client meetings. The autofocus feature maintains clarity even when moving or adjusting position during a call.

In low-light conditions, the camera’s enhanced sensor minimizes noise and maintains color accuracy. This means you can appear professional regardless of your environment. The plug-and-play USB-C connection simplifies setup, reducing technical difficulties during important meetings.

Comparison with Other Webcams

Compared to other webcams in its class, the Elgato Facecam Pro 2026 offers higher resolution and better low-light performance. While some competitors focus on 1080p or 1440p, the 4K capability provides future-proofing as video conferencing standards evolve. Its autofocus and privacy shutter add convenience not always found in similar devices.

Pros and Cons

  • Pros: High-resolution video, excellent autofocus, low-light performance, easy setup
  • Cons: Higher price point, larger physical size, may require more bandwidth for 4K streaming
